QuickBooks Error 6000 83

QuickBooks error 6000 83 is a common 6000 series of errors that can arise while working or accessing the company file. This error code can occur due to many possible reasons, like misconfigured hosting settings or damaged company files. The issue causes a disconnection between QuickBooks and the server and can prevent users from working on their company data. Common Causes for the QuickBooks Desktop Error 6000 83

Error code 6000 83 in QuickBooks Desktop can occur due to the following common reasons –

  • You are storing your company file on an external storage drive rather than the internal storage of your computer, which is causing access issues.
  • The backup file you are trying to access has an incorrect file name, or the file name contains special characters.
  • The hosting settings on your server PC are incorrectly set up, and the support files are damaged/corrupted.
  • QuickBooks is unable to establish a connection with the server PC and cannot connect with the company data file.
  • The anti-virus or 3rdparty program is causing an obstruction, which is preventing the user from accessing the company file.

Solution 1 – Change the Backup File Location by Creating a New Data Folder

You can create a new folder to store the backup file and address the QB error code 6000 83.

  1. On your server computer, access the QB screen and tap on the Filetab to Quit QuickBooks Desktop, and navigate to the This PC
  2. Double-click on the This PC icon and navigate to the Cdrive to create a new folder by right-clicking and selecting the New Folder
  3. Name the folder QB Testand create a backup for your company data file, and choose a location to store the backup.
  4. Select QB Test and restore the backup of your company file to check if the error has been repaired, and if not, run the backup as your primary company file.
  5. Now, change the name of the older company file to avoid confusion and overwriting, and check the status of the 6000 error.

Solution 2 – Run the File Doctor Utility from the Tool Hub to Mend the File Corruption

If you are unable to run your company file correctly, you can fix the damage by accessing the file doctor tool from the tool hub.

  1. Download the QuickBooks tool hub setup file from Intuit’s official site and follow the on-screen instructions to install it on your PC.
  2. Open the installed utility, and navigate to the Company File Issuestab to locate the file doctor tool.
  3. Select the QuickBooks File Doctor Tool option and browse your company file to select the Check your File and Network option and run a file repair.
